Transaction 70c05c71bfe470b5691af2d766b9afdf5ecca9fc40f816446e5e44a91875eb58
1 Input
2 Outputs
- 70c05c71bfe470b5691af2d766b9afdf5ecca9fc40f816446e5e44a91875eb58:0
- 70c05c71bfe470b5691af2d766b9afdf5ecca9fc40f816446e5e44a91875eb58:1
value 124824
address 3916QGmJPykk4rU7umVmD3ew8oLkJA97iJ
value 2653890
address 18HGUqduAcbpkMf3jvC6RRzyhqtuPDtyPf